While using the stick the twist access stopped working during a game. Now i have restarted my computer and recalibrated several times, but still on the VKB software i see no input for the twist axis.

I had this issue last year and it seemed to just fix itself, now i have it again. Could you please help fix this and explain why this is happening?

Your firmware is very old, please update both firmware and software from here(use VKBDevCfg instead of Wizzo). If it's still not recognized you'll have to open up the grip and see if the magnet is still in front of the board. This video shows what you should expect to find inside the stick.

Try to remove Wizzo (and no longer install it) and disassemble the handle, reconnect not the main 3-pin cable, but the 4-pin cable with a twist.
The twist will work when the numbers here change after calibration.
